The major product formed when 1, 1, 1-trichloro-propane is treated with aqueous potassium hydroxide is propionic acid.
Alc. KOH causes elimination in the molecule of haloalkane generally, while aq. KOH leads to substitution. Here aqueous KOH is used, substitution reaction is most preferable.
The initial reaction is the nucleophilic substitution, which will form a trihydroxy compound, since, three hydroxy group on one carbon is unstable and result in dehydration and form carboxylic acid.
